New Sandy Hook School Finished Under Budget: Report
The new school came in over $1 million under budget, aiding the financially struggling state.

SANDY HOOK, CT — The state's most famous school building finished $1.5 million under its planned budget, at a time when fiscal responsibility is paramount in Hartford, according to multiple reports including the News Times.
The final savings total became clear when books were closed on the project. The school opened last August, on the same site where 20 students and six educators were slain in the worst crime in state history.
Following the 2012 massacre, the state pledged $50 million to help rebuild the school. Students attended a school in Monroe while the old building was knocked down and the new building erected in its place.
